Here’s How To Apply For Withdrawal RM500 From EPF Account 2 Starting Tomorrow

The Prime Minister announced last week that members of the Employees Provident Fund (EPF) would be allowed to withdraw up to RM500 per month from their account. This production facility, known as i-Lestari, will be available starting April 1, 2020.

The i-Lestari withdrawal aims to ease the financial burden of members to meet the basic monthly needs of the Covid-19 pandemic. Below are what people need to know about i-Lestari:

i-Lestari Withdrawal basically functions as follows:

  1. Withdrawals can only be made from Akaun 2.
  2. The number of monthly withdrawals one is entitled to be counted from the date of receipt of the approved application for withdrawal, until the end of the facility’s validity period, i.e. 31 March 2021.
  3. Requested withdrawals will be credited to the member’s bank account on a monthly basis (recurring for the subsequent months)

Example:

  1. If an application is approved in April 2020, the number of monthly withdrawals one is entitled to be the maximum amount of 12 monthly withdrawals.
  2. If an application is approved in September 2020, the number of monthly withdrawals one is entitled to be 7 months.
  3. If an application is approved in March 2021, the number of monthly withdrawals one is entitled to be 1 month.

The i-Lestari Withdrawal facility is open to:

  1. Malaysian citizens, permanent residents, and non-Malaysians;
  2. Age below 55; and
  3. Have savings in Akaun 2.

Duration of application for i-Lestari Withdrawal application.

  • Members can submit the i-Sustainable Withdrawal application form from April 1, 2020, to March 31, 2021. (Applications must be approved by the EPF by March 31, 2021)

Amount members are allowed to withdraw under i-Lestari Withdrawal

  • The permitted amount under i-Lestari Withdrawal ranges from a minimum of RM50 to a maximum of RM500 a month; subject to the amount of savings available in the member’s Akaun 2 at the time of withdrawal payment being made for the particular month.
  • If the total amount of savings in Akaun 2 is lesser than the amount applied for, then the amount of withdrawal for that particular month shall be whatever the remaining amount is.

When will payment be made to EPF members?

  • For withdrawal applications received in April 2020, payment will be made in May 2020.
  • For withdrawal applications received after April 2020, withdrawal payment will be made from the date the withdrawal application is received by the EPF.

How to apply?

A complete application form can be submitted to the EPF beginning 1 April 2020 through the following methods:

  1. Online (use e-Pengeluaran via Member’s i-Akaun)
  2. By e-mail addressed to: ilestarimohon@epf.gov.my; or
  3. By post addressed to:
    Kumpulan Wang Simpanan Pekerja, Karung Berkunci No 220, Jalan Sultan 46720, Petaling Jaya with the note (Attention to i-Lestari) written on the front of the envelope

To ensure faster approval process members are encouraged to submit their applications online via e-Pengeluaran. Manual submissions sent through methods (b) and (c) will take a longer processing time. However, withdrawal applications for non-Malaysians can be made via methods (b) and (c) only.

Why is i-Lestari Withdrawal only allowed once every month?

  • The monthly withdrawal frequency is designed to supplement the monthly source of income to help members meet their monthly basic financial needs.

Why is i-Lestari Withdrawal only available for one year?

  • The i-Lestari Withdrawal Facility is intended as a financial relief to assist EPF members to weather the impact of COVID-19 pandemic. The Government will continue to monitor the development of the current situation and the necessity of this facility from time to time.
